Google
What an interesting place! At 07.45pm there is already a huge line in front of the restaurant. At 08.00 you get in and then everything works super fast and professional. It's a huge place so I would guess 100 people capacity. The ordering is fast and flawless, food arrives quickly as well. Compared to Bariloche prices its cheap, especially if you pay the dishes for two! Milanesas are good! I would not go for the suiz one though. That's just an enormous amount of cheese.
